Transaction 39859c0aba8b539277ceddf6614b663763f33f718aca1b4d553d9e84eb7ac36f
1 Input
1 Output
-
39859c0aba8b539277ceddf6614b663763f33f718aca1b4d553d9e84eb7ac36f:0
- value
- 17363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 850967455dfcb01cab9188e0d37e048b7fbaa9ff OP_EQUAL
- address
- 3DpT4R9B1wFuBw9Mf3Gb2Zh1xbJCXYDrpj